Seattle Mariners vs Kansas City Royals 9/16/25 MLB Free Pick
Alright, folks, we've got an exciting matchup on our hands between the Seattle Mariners and the Kansas City Royals. Let's dive into the numbers and see where the betting opportunities lie for this game.
First up, the Seattle Mariners are coming into this game with a solid two-game winning streak. They currently sit in the 2nd position in the standings with 71 wins and 61 losses. Their offense has been putting up an average of 4.6 runs per game while allowing 4.4 runs against. The Mariners have been strong at home with a 40-26 record but have struggled slightly on the road with a 31-35 record.
On the other side, the Kansas City Royals are looking to bounce back after a recent loss. They are also in the 2nd position in the standings with 67 wins and 65 losses. The Royals have been scoring an average of 3.9 runs per game and conceding the same amount. They have been decent at home with a 36-30 record but have mirrored the Mariners on the road with a 31-35 record.
In terms of power ratings, the Mariners hold a power rating of 110.30 with a win percentage of 0.538. On the flip side, the Royals have a power rating of -42.05 with a win percentage of 0.508. These numbers give us a good indication of each team's overall performance and potential in this matchup.
Now, let's talk about the game odds. The Mariners are listed as the away team with a run line of -1.5 and odds of +120. The Royals, as the home team, have a run line of +1.5 and odds of -140. The moneyline odds are -143 for the Mariners and +120 for the Royals. The over/under is set at 8.5 runs with both the over and under carrying odds of -120.
Considering the Mariners' current form and slightly better power rating, they might have a slight edge in this matchup. However, the Royals have been solid at home and could make this game a close one. The over/under of 8.5 runs also presents an intriguing betting opportunity depending on how you see the game playing out.
